Seward Area Hospice exists to provide compassionate end of life care to enable comfort, dignity, and choice for the individual and the family. We provide community members with the support they need while facing the end of life, coping with serious illness or experiencing the loss of a loved one. Care focuses on quality of life and helps the clients to make the most of their remaining time in whatever place they call home.

Our free services include:
Trained Volunteer Companions – Grief & Bereavement Support - Access to Community Resources - Community Education – Assistance with Advance Directives

We know end of life can be overwhelming. We would love to talk to you, even if you are not quite ready for hospice yet, to provide information and advice so if there comes a time when you or a loved one needs hospice you are familiar with the help available to you. As Dame Cicely Saunders, the founder of hospice, puts it, “You matter because you are you, and you matter to the end of your life. We will do all we can not only to help you die peacefully, but to also live until you die.”

Youth 360 - Seward is a primary prevention program being funded through federal grant monies for the implementation of the Icelandic Prevention Model (IPM).  The IPM is a model the county of Iceland began developing in the mid 1990’s when they saw their teen substance use rates reported as the highest in Europe. A wide range of stakeholders collaborated to form a data informed model aimed at reducing teen substance use. 

The result was incredibly successful.  Iceland saw the rate of its 15/16 year old’s reporting being drunk in the last 30 days go from 42 percent in 1995 to 6 percent in 2018, impressively this number has stayed below 10 percent since 2010, the lowest in Europe.  Iceland has created an open source model for any other interested appropriate entity to follow, in hopes of helping these groups reduce their rates of youth substance use, and this is what Youth 360 Seward is committed to do for Seward.

Serving the Native communities of the Chugach Region

NORTHSTAR HEALTH CLINIC
This is the hub of Chugachmiut’s health care system in the region. Located in Seward, NSHC is dedicated to quality primary care with a focus on preventative patient education and screening. 

The clinic provides acute and chronic illness care, emergency care, illness prevention education, routine screening exams, well childcare and immunizations, prenatal care, and behavioral health.

The dental clinic provides services to beneficiaries and their family members, and staff travel to our four remote villages to provide residents state-of-the-art dental care.
